ActionScript® 3.0 Referenzhandbuch für die Adobe® Flash®-Plattform
Home  |  Liste der Pakete und Klassen ausblenden |  Pakete  |  Klassen  |  Neue Funktionen  |  Stichwortverzeichnis  |  Anhänge  |  Warum auf Englisch?
Filter: Daten werden vom Server abgerufen...
Daten werden vom Server abgerufen...
coldfusion.service.mxml 

Ldap  - AS3 CF

Paketcoldfusion.service.mxml
Klassepublic class Ldap
VererbungLdap Inheritance BasicService Inheritance InternalConfig Inheritance Object

Sprachversion: ActionScript 3.0
Produktversion: ColdFusion 9
Laufzeitversionen: Flash Player 9, AIR 1.0

The proxy class for ldap services exposed by ColdFusion.



Öffentliche Eigenschaften
 EigenschaftDefiniert von
 Inheritedaction : String
Action string for the service.
BasicService
  attributes : String
For queries: comma-delimited list of attributes to return.
Ldap
 InheritedcfContextRoot : String
Context root of the ColdFusion server.
InternalConfig
 InheritedcfPort : int
Port where the ColdFusion server is running.
InternalConfig
 InheritedcfServer : String
Name or IP address of the ColdFusion server.
InternalConfig
 Inheritedconstructor : Object
Ein Verweis auf das Klassenobjekt oder die Konstruktorfunktion für eine angegebene Objektinstanz.
Object
  delimiter : String
Separator between attribute name-value pairs.
Ldap
 Inheriteddestination : String
Specifies the destination for the remoting call.
InternalConfig
  dn : String
Distinguished name, for update action, for example, "cn=BobJensen,o=AceIndustry,c=US"
Ldap
  filter : String
Search criteria for action="query".
Ldap
  maxrows : String
Maximum number of entries for LDAP queries.
Ldap
  modifyType : String
How to process an attribute in a multivalue list: add: appends it to any attributes. delete: deletes it from the set of attributes. replace: replaces it with specified attributes.
Ldap
  password : String
Password that corresponds to user name.
Ldap
  port : String
Port.
Ldap
  rebind : String
yes: attempts to rebind referral callback and reissue query by referred address using original credentials. no: referred connections are anonymous.
Ldap
  referral : String
Integer.
Ldap
  scope : String
Scope of search, from entry specified in start attribute for action="Query" .
Ldap
  secure : Boolean
Specifies the security to employ, and the required information.
Ldap
 InheritedsecureHttp : Boolean
Boolean value that specifies if secure HTTP is used: yes: uses secure HTTP no: does not use secure HTTP
InternalConfig
  separator : String
Delimiter to separate attribute values of multi-value attributes.
Ldap
  server : String
Host name or IP address of LDAP server.
Ldap
 InheritedservicePassword : String
Password to access ColdFusion services.
InternalConfig
 InheritedserviceUserName : String
Username to access ColdFusion services.
InternalConfig
  sort : String
Attribute(s) by which to sort query results.
Ldap
  sortControl : String
nocase: case-insensitive sort asc: ascending (a to z) case-sensitive sort. desc: descending (z to a) case-sensitive sort.
Ldap
  start : String
Distinguished name of entry to be used to start a search.
Ldap
  startRow : String
Used with action="query".
Ldap
  timeout : String
Maximum length of time, in milliseconds, to wait for LDAP processing.
Ldap
  userName : String
User ID.
Ldap
Öffentliche Methoden
 MethodeDefiniert von
  
Creates an instance of the Ldap class.
Ldap
 Inherited
addEventListener(type:String, listener:Function, useCapture:Boolean = false, priority:int = 0, useWeakReference:Boolean = false):void
Registers an event listener object with an EventDispatcher object so that the listener receives notification of an event.
BasicService
 Inherited
Dispatches an event into the event flow.
BasicService
  
Sends information to the ColdFusion service based on the action and the attributes that the user sets.
Ldap
 Inherited
Returns the RemoteObject instance used by the proxy classes to make the remote object call.
BasicService
 Inherited
Checks whether the EventDispatcher object has any listeners registered for a specific type of event.
BasicService
 Inherited
Gibt an, ob für ein Objekt eine bestimmte Eigenschaft definiert wurde.
Object
 Inherited
Gibt an, ob eine Instanz der Object-Klasse in der Prototypkette des Objekts vorhanden ist, das als Parameter angegeben wurde.
Object
 Inherited
Gibt an, ob die angegebene Eigenschaft vorhanden ist und durchlaufen werden kann.
Object
 Inherited
removeEventListener(type:String, listener:Function, useCapture:Boolean = false):void
Removes a listener from the EventDispatcher object.
BasicService
 Inherited
Legt die Verfügbarkeit einer dynamischen Eigenschaft für Schleifenoperationen fest.
Object
 Inherited
Gibt die Stringdarstellung dieses Objekts zurück, formatiert entsprechend den Konventionen des Gebietsschemas.
Object
 Inherited
Gibt das angegebene Objekt als String zurück.
Object
 Inherited
Gibt den Grundwert des angegebenen Objekts zurück.
Object
 Inherited
Checks whether an event listener is registered with this EventDispatcher object or any of its ancestors for the specified event type.
BasicService
Geschützte Methoden
 MethodeDefiniert von
  
[override] This is the overriden function of the default implementation is BasicService.
Ldap
Ereignisse
 Ereignis Übersicht Definiert von
 InheritedDispatched when a ColdFusion service call fails.BasicService
 InheritedDispatched when a ColdFusion service call returns successfully.BasicService
Eigenschaftendetails

attributes

Eigenschaft
public var attributes:String

Sprachversion: ActionScript 3.0
Produktversion: ColdFusion 9
Laufzeitversionen: Flash Player 9, AIR 1.0

For queries: comma-delimited list of attributes to return. For queries, to get all attributes, specify ".

delimiter

Eigenschaft 
public var delimiter:String

Sprachversion: ActionScript 3.0
Produktversion: ColdFusion 9
Laufzeitversionen: Flash Player 9, AIR 1.0

Separator between attribute name-value pairs. Use this attribute if either of these situations exist:

  • The attributes attribute specifies more than one item.
  • An attribute contains the default delimiter (semicolon), for example: mgrpmsgrejecttext;lang-en

Der Standardwert ist ; (semicolon).

dn

Eigenschaft 
public var dn:String

Sprachversion: ActionScript 3.0
Produktversion: ColdFusion 9
Laufzeitversionen: Flash Player 9, AIR 1.0

Distinguished name, for update action, for example, "cn=BobJensen,o=AceIndustry,c=US"

filter

Eigenschaft 
public var filter:String

Sprachversion: ActionScript 3.0
Produktversion: ColdFusion 9
Laufzeitversionen: Flash Player 9, AIR 1.0

Search criteria for action="query".

Der Standardwert ist "objectclass =.

maxrows

Eigenschaft 
public var maxrows:String

Sprachversion: ActionScript 3.0
Produktversion: ColdFusion 9
Laufzeitversionen: Flash Player 9, AIR 1.0

Maximum number of entries for LDAP queries.

modifyType

Eigenschaft 
public var modifyType:String

Sprachversion: ActionScript 3.0
Produktversion: ColdFusion 9
Laufzeitversionen: Flash Player 9, AIR 1.0

How to process an attribute in a multivalue list:

  • add: appends it to any attributes.
  • delete: deletes it from the set of attributes.
  • replace: replaces it with specified attributes.

Der Standardwert ist replace .

password

Eigenschaft 
public var password:String

Sprachversion: ActionScript 3.0
Produktversion: ColdFusion 9
Laufzeitversionen: Flash Player 9, AIR 1.0

Password that corresponds to user name. If secure ="CFSSL_BASIC", V2 encrypts the password before transmission.

port

Eigenschaft 
public var port:String

Sprachversion: ActionScript 3.0
Produktversion: ColdFusion 9
Laufzeitversionen: Flash Player 9, AIR 1.0

Port.

Der Standardwert ist 389.

rebind

Eigenschaft 
public var rebind:String

Sprachversion: ActionScript 3.0
Produktversion: ColdFusion 9
Laufzeitversionen: Flash Player 9, AIR 1.0

  • yes: attempts to rebind referral callback and reissue query by referred address using original credentials.
  • no: referred connections are anonymous.

Der Standardwert ist no.

referral

Eigenschaft 
public var referral:String

Sprachversion: ActionScript 3.0
Produktversion: ColdFusion 9
Laufzeitversionen: Flash Player 9, AIR 1.0

Integer. Number of hops allowed in a referral. A value of 0 disables referred addresses for LDAP; no data is returned.

scope

Eigenschaft 
public var scope:String

Sprachversion: ActionScript 3.0
Produktversion: ColdFusion 9
Laufzeitversionen: Flash Player 9, AIR 1.0

Scope of search, from entry specified in start attribute for action="Query" .

  • oneLevel: entries one level below entry.
  • base: only the entry.
  • subtree: entry and all levels below it.

Der Standardwert ist oneLevel.

secure

Eigenschaft 
public var secure:Boolean

Sprachversion: ActionScript 3.0
Produktversion: ColdFusion 9
Laufzeitversionen: Flash Player 9, AIR 1.0

Specifies the security to employ, and the required information. If you specify this attribute, its value must be CFSSL_BASIC, which provides V2 SSL encryption and server authentication.

separator

Eigenschaft 
public var separator:String

Sprachversion: ActionScript 3.0
Produktversion: ColdFusion 9
Laufzeitversionen: Flash Player 9, AIR 1.0

Delimiter to separate attribute values of multi-value attributes. Used by query, add, and modify actions, and by cfldap to output multi-value attributes.

Der Standardwert ist , (comma).

server

Eigenschaft 
public var server:String

Sprachversion: ActionScript 3.0
Produktversion: ColdFusion 9
Laufzeitversionen: Flash Player 9, AIR 1.0

Host name or IP address of LDAP server.

sort

Eigenschaft 
public var sort:String

Sprachversion: ActionScript 3.0
Produktversion: ColdFusion 9
Laufzeitversionen: Flash Player 9, AIR 1.0

Attribute(s) by which to sort query results. Use a comma delimiter.

sortControl

Eigenschaft 
public var sortControl:String

Sprachversion: ActionScript 3.0
Produktversion: ColdFusion 9
Laufzeitversionen: Flash Player 9, AIR 1.0

  • nocase: case-insensitive sort
  • asc: ascending (a to z) case-sensitive sort.
  • desc: descending (z to a) case-sensitive sort.

Der Standardwert ist asc.

start

Eigenschaft 
public var start:String

Sprachversion: ActionScript 3.0
Produktversion: ColdFusion 9
Laufzeitversionen: Flash Player 9, AIR 1.0

Distinguished name of entry to be used to start a search.

startRow

Eigenschaft 
public var startRow:String

Sprachversion: ActionScript 3.0
Produktversion: ColdFusion 9
Laufzeitversionen: Flash Player 9, AIR 1.0

Used with action="query". First row of LDAP query to insert into a ColdFusion query.

Der Standardwert ist 1.

timeout

Eigenschaft 
public var timeout:String

Sprachversion: ActionScript 3.0
Produktversion: ColdFusion 9
Laufzeitversionen: Flash Player 9, AIR 1.0

Maximum length of time, in milliseconds, to wait for LDAP processing.

Der Standardwert ist 60000.

userName

Eigenschaft 
public var userName:String

Sprachversion: ActionScript 3.0
Produktversion: ColdFusion 9
Laufzeitversionen: Flash Player 9, AIR 1.0

User ID.

Der Standardwert ist (anonymous).

Konstruktordetails

Ldap

()Konstruktor
public function Ldap()

Sprachversion: ActionScript 3.0
Produktversion: ColdFusion 9
Laufzeitversionen: Flash Player 9, AIR 1.0

Creates an instance of the Ldap class.

Methodendetails

convertResultInEvent

()Methode
override protected function convertResultInEvent(event:ResultEvent):ColdFusionServiceResultEvent

This is the overriden function of the default implementation is BasicService. This function checks if the result returned is 2d array of serviceelement If it is, it converts it into a 2d array of objects and creates an instance of ColdFusionResultEvent and returns the event.

Parameter

event:ResultEvent

Rückgabewerte
ColdFusionServiceResultEvent

execute

()Methode 
public function execute():void

Sprachversion: ActionScript 3.0
Produktversion: ColdFusion 9
Laufzeitversionen: Flash Player 10, AIR 1.5

Sends information to the ColdFusion service based on the action and the attributes that the user sets.





[ X ]Warum auf Englisch?
Inhalt des ActionScript 3.0-Referenzhandbuchs wird in englischer Sprache angezeigt

Nicht alle Teile des ActionScript 3.0-Referenzhandbuchs wurden in alle Sprachen übersetzt. Wenn der Text zu einem Sprachelement nicht übersetzt wurde, wird er auf Englisch angezeigt. Zum Beispiel wurden die Informationen zur ga.controls.HelpBox-Klasse nicht in andere Sprachen übersetzt. In der deutschen Version des Referenzhandbuchs erscheint der Abschnitt zur ga.controls.HelpBox-Klasse deshalb auf Englisch.